WebOct 1, 2004 · It says, "When an inguinal hernia repair is performed in addition to an orchiopexy, both code 54640 and the appropriate inguinal hernia repair code 49495-49525 should be reported." When CPT defines a code or interprets that definition, we should follow those recommendations, unless Medicare trumps it with a rule of its own. WebIf the patient has a normal contralateral testicle and cancer is confirmed in the mass, a completion radical orchiectomy should be performed. If the patient has (or had) cancer in the contralateral testicle, the pathologist should confirm negative margins before leaving the remainder of the testicle.
